Description
The IF-VIDITEST anti-VZV kit is intended for the detection of IgG and IgM antibodies to varicella-zoster virus (VZV) by indirect immunofluorescence. This kit is intended for the diagnosis of diseases induced or associated with VZV, such as varicella and shingles (herpes zoster). It can also be used to characterize VZV-related complications and generalized infections in immunodeficient patients. The assays are ideal for providing confirmation of results obtained with ELISA kits.
 
This kit includes slides with a surface coated with both human embryonic lung cells infected with VZV and with non-infected cells. Human antibodies to VTV, if present in a tested sample, bind to the viral antigens present in the infected cells. The bound antibodies are detected with anti-human IgG or anti-human IgM antibodies labeled with fluorescein-isothiocyanate (FITC conjugate). A fluorescent microscope is used to observe specific fluorescence. The uninfected cells serve as an internal control of the assay.
